Description of Work Done.

The task for this assignment was to look into usability testing and to perform some our own usability task. We all did some of the work in all areas of the task. This way all our strengths would be evident in each section, but also each person’s weaknesses would be covered by other people doing the work as well. I feel that this has given us a very strong piece of work, as everything is thought out throughout the assignment well and we all knew exactly what needed to be done. This organisation was helped by having a single group leader throughout the work. As Kyle was overseeing what we were doing and was there to answer any questions that people had, it gave us a firm leader ship. The most important area of the work to do was the actual testing. The testing was completed in a set environment that was the same for each of the testers. This gave us a more professional feel to the work as everything was controlled by us and it also allowed us to receive very accurate data throughout the test.

Reflection and Issues Identified (SWOT)

Overall the project went very well and there was no real problem that we had throughout the whole assignment. This was due to the amount of planning that we did at the start of the project and the constant meetings that we had throughout to be sure that we all knew exactly what needed to be done, and the exact things that we all had to produce. This really meant that we wouldn’t have a problem and really we didn’t. The biggest strength in the whole project was the planning. Because we thought about everything we would need to do in the project and even planned solutions to problems that could occur and had a backup plan, such as where to stage the tests, we were much organised as a whole.
Plan of Action (SMART)
Our plan of action was to spend a set amount of time at the start of the assignment and look at making specific goals and make sure they are realistic for us to achieve. This gave the project a great framework for us to work within as we did more and more work for the assignment. We gave us a rough time limit in which to get the work done as well. This meant that we would be getting through the work at a nice relaxed pace and wouldn’t have to spend a couple of days at the end simply trying to get the work finished. This also meant that the work would be at a higher quality as we would have time to think through what needs to be said in the report and to also get everything structured correctly so that it all read well and the English was at a high quality.
